Phone number ☎️ 01162480425 👆 is reported as a persistent source of scam calls impersonating TalkTalk representatives, often using pushy tactics to extract personal or banking details. Callers frequently hang up when challenged and may display aggressive behaviour if confronted. The originating number is misleading, with claims of different locations, and attempts to install monitoring software have been reported. Many recipients receive multiple calls per day, with some callers adopting various accents and voices to appear convincing. Victims are advised not to engage, refrain from sharing any information, and consider reporting the number to authorities. TalkTalk customers and non-customers alike should remain vigilant, as these fraudulent calls attempt to exploit trust to gain access to sensitive information.

About 01 Numbers
These numbers refer to specific locations in the UK and are commonly used by homes and businesses. Sometimes referred to as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the costs for these geographic numbers are based on the time of day. Several service providers offer call packages that grant free calls during particular times. Call costs from mobile phones are based on the chosen calling plan, with several plans incorporating these numbers in their free call packages.
